SQM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

226 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sociedad Química y Minera de Chile (SQM)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$2.35B — up 19% from $1.98B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new SQM positions and 43 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 80 added to existing stakes and 68 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$145M. The largest seller was ClearBridge Investments, exiting entirely with an estimated $75M sold.
